The tradition of chocolate eggs first became popular in Europe around the end of the 19th century. Today, 2.5 million Perugina eggs, the equivalent of 671 tons, are sold each season. Perugina offers three distinct varieties of its chocolate eggs for Easter: a dark chocolate Baci egg, a white chocolate Baci egg and a milk chocolate version, the Perugina egg. The Baci egg is named for Perugina’s most popular confection and includes four Baci inside each hollow egg. “Baci” is the Italian word for “kisses” and the iconic Baci confections are each wrapped in a special message of love written in five different languages and tucked into the foil wrapper.
